Diane P. Shanks, 58, Stratford, passed away peacefully with family at her side on Tuesday, Dec. 17, 2019, at Marshfield Medical Center.

A memorial service was held at 11 a.m. on Saturday, Dec. 21, 2019, at Zion Lutheran Church, Stratford, where the family received relatives and friends from 9 a.m. until the service time. Rev. Sue Eidahl presided. The Auxiliary to the V.F.W. Post 6352 conducted a prayer service at 10 a.m. on Saturday at the church. Burial will be in Hillside Cemetery, Marshfield, at a later date. Sauter/Rembs Funeral Home, Stratford, assisted the family.

Diane was born on Oct. 30, 1961, in Portage, to Max and Patricia (Heit) Duffy and was a 1980 graduate of Montello High School. She also was a 1985 graduate of the University of Wisconsin Whitewater where she received her Bachelor of Arts degree in education. She was employed by the Colby School District and spent almost all of her teaching career as an English teacher there for 32 years as well as being part of the drama department.

On June 22, 1996, Diane married the love of her life, William L. Shanks, Sr. They remained happily married for 21 years until William’s death on Sept. 30, 2017.

She was a life member of the Veterans of Foreign Wars Auxiliary to Post 6352 where she served as secretary, hospital chairperson and she volunteered at the steak feeds and honor flight breakfasts. She enjoyed camping each year with her family at Fort McCoy and traveling with her husband as much as possible.

She is survived by stepsons: William (Karen) Shanks, Jr., Edward (Cherada) Shanks and Randy Englebretson. She is also survived by her nephew, Scott Duffy; and her six grandchildren.

She was preceded in death by her parents, Max and Patricia; her husband, William; two brothers: Robert and Joe; and two sisters: Linda and Debra.
